Facebook slapped one of its politicized "fact check" labels on a peer reviewed article in one of the world's oldest medical journals and its editors are livid.  The British Medical Journal has been published since 1840 by the British Medical Association. In November, it published a peer reviewed article pointing out serious flaws in Pfizer's testing of its Covid vaccine.  That led Facebook's "fact check" contractor Lead Stories to place a "misleading" label on the British Medical Journal article, meaning it could not be shared on Facebook.  The editors have published a letter they sent to Mark Zuckerburg calling Facebook out on its flawed "fact check" process.
